Ferro Manganese Market To Thrive On Burgeoning Infrastructure And Renewable Energy Sectors

Ferro manganese is an important alloy element which is used as a deoxidizing agent and offers excellent toughness and hardenability. It finds major application in steel production and construction industry owing to its strength and heat resistance properties.


The global ferro manganese market is estimated to be valued at US$ 81.8 Mn in 2024 and is expected to exhibit a CAGR of 7.3% over the forecast period from 2024 to 2031.


Ferro manganese is an alloy of manganese and iron that is primarily used to remove oxygen and sulfur impurities during steel production. It improves the hardness, stiffness and tensile strength of steel while also lowering its melting point. Ferro manganese contains 65-90% of manganese, making it ideal for modifying steel properties. Impact of COVID-19 on Ferro Manganese Market Growth

The COVID-19 pandemic has significantly impacted the growth of the global ferro manganese market. During the initial outbreak of the virus, production facilities and foundries involved in the manufacturing of ferro manganese had to temporarily shut down or significantly reduce their operations to comply with lockdown and social distancing norms implemented globally to contain the spread of the virus. This disrupted the supply chain and suspended ferro manganese supply to various end-use industries such as construction, automotive, shipbuilding, etc.


As the pandemic progressed, the demand from these end-use industries also declined sharply due to reductions in manufacturing and construction activities across the world. However, with countries easing lockdown restrictions and economic activities gradually resuming in a phased manner post Q2 2020, the ferro manganese market has started demonstrating signs of recovery. The construction and infrastructure development activities are rebounding in major economies leading to increased demand for steel and thereby ferro manganese. The manufacturers are ramping up their production capacities to cater to the rising demand. However, uncertainties around future waves of virus spread and emergence of new variants still remain a challenge and risk for the market's growth trajectory in the coming years. Ongoing vaccination drives globally are expected to support sustained economic recovery and drive the ferro manganese consumption higher over the long run.
